**Migration Guide — Step 4: Hushline Deduplicator**

Before switching traffic, update the deduplicator settings to match the new ingestion path. The old fingerprinting keys are no longer valid, and stale ones will cause duplicate pages during the transition window. Apply the change in staging first and verify suppression counts. The required configuration values are as follows.

deployment values, yadug-bawif:
[framir]
team = pelox
access_code = ac_a38ab2
owner = tamion.julael
host = framir.tolvaqlabs.test
port = 11211
peer = tammir.zemvargrid.local
salt = 2215ef03
pin = 1541

// Heads up, release folks: this caps rows buffered in memory during
// spreadsheet export from Tallyfox. We learned the hard way that holding
// a full 500k-row workbook in RAM takes the worker down with it.
// 20k keeps peak usage under ~300MB while streaming the rest to disk.
// Don't raise this without load-testing on the small export pods first.
// Verified against the build noted below.

trace token, fafog-kageg: htk4_98e6

Ticket: DEDUP-314 — Suppression bypass when alerts carry mixed-case hostnames

Hey, flagging this for the security review pass on Brindlewood's on-call deduplicator. If two alerts differ only in hostname casing, the fingerprinter treats them as distinct, so suppression rules can be dodged by anyone who controls the alert source. Probably just needs a normalize step before hashing, but worth checking whether that changes the stored fingerprint format. Repro is attached from the staging pager feed. The failing trace token is below.

session token of kageg-tahop = htk14_af3c1ccccb7dcf

Facilities Ticket — Cleaning Crew Access, Brindle Annex

For new starters handling evening lock-up: the Sorano Cleaning crew arrives nightly at 21:30 via the annex side door. Check their rota sheet, note arrival in the log, and ensure the storeroom is relocked afterward. To let them through the side door, enter the access code below.

badge for yaweg-hafog: bdg-GX-6